Saturday 6 June
A day to stretch your legs, explore or simply relax aboard.
11:00 Optional scenic walk to Newport (approx. 2.4 miles / 50 minutes) along the beautiful Medina Greenway. Newport is the county town of the Isle of Wight and its primary commercial centre. Located on the River Medina, it features historic Georgian/Victorian architecture with numerous shops, pubs and coffee shops. Quay Arts is recommended for coffee – a charming arts centre in a converted 19th-Century warehouse with waterside terrace and excellent homemade cakes. For lunch, try the pub next door, The Bargeman’s Rest – a favourite for real ales and home-cooked pub food by the river. If you don’t fancy the walk back, hop on the No 5 bus to Whippingham Forge with a 10 minute walk back to the Folly pontoon. 19.30 hrs – Rally Dinner at The Folly Inn. Enjoy a lively evening at this historic riverside inn, whose origins date back to an 18th-century smuggler’s barge. With live music from 20:00, expect a great atmosphere — and possibly some dancing!
